What is the Variable Universal Life Insurance Application Rider Worksheet?
The Variable Universal Life Insurance Application Rider Worksheet is a critical document in the life insurance application process. It serves the purpose of facilitating the addition of riders to existing life insurance policies, which enhances the coverage provided to the insured party. This form must be signed by several parties, including the Proposed or Primary Insured, Covered Insured Rider, Parent or Guardian, and a Witness to ensure the validity of the document.

Who Needs the Variable Universal Life Insurance Application Rider Worksheet?
The form is primarily designed for individuals seeking to add coverage through riders on their life insurance. This includes the Proposed or Primary Insured, who is the individual applying for the insurance, and the Covered Insured Rider, who is typically an additional insured party. In scenarios where minors are involved, a Parent or Guardian must also sign the form, ensuring that all legal requirements are met.
